Lambro 175
Italian Production Dates: 1963 - August 1965
Frame Prefix: M41
The Lambro 175 was launched in September 1963. They began from Chassis Number 499501. It is a culmination of the technical amendments made to the Lambretta Li 175 Series 2 although rebadged to bring it in line with the new Lambro 200 as they were marketed alongside each other as a range. Identifying features include the single headlight, non-suicide doors and 200cc stud spacing with a sleeved barrel.
The Chassis Prefix was changed from T41 to M41 previously to the badge change. Although we have yet to prove the exact date, we suspect it was in June 1963 with the launch of the M42 Lambro 200 and therefore there are cross over Lambros with the M41 chassis prefix.

Frame and Cabin
Frame | Tubular Steel backbone with superstructures for the support of the cab and the body. Cradle for spare wheel |
Front suspension: | by means of rocker arms connected to levers with end balls compressing through guide pistons two variable pitch helical springs. |
Possibility of application of the shock absorbers | |
Rear suspension: | with two longitudinal leaf springs anchored to the frame at the front and shackled at the rear |
Possibility of application of the shock absorbers | |
Cabin: | Pressed steel, rear window equipped with rear curtain, instrument panel, holes for attaching the door hinges, rear-view mirror. |
Windscreen: | Curved glass windscreen with rubber beading. |
Windscreen Wiper: | Windscreen wiper hand operated (an electrical windscreen wiper can be fitted in place) |
Seat: | Double seat bench over engine cover |
Doors: | Doors (accessory) complete with glass windows (left hand door with normal type lock, right hand door with locking device in handle). |

Electrical Equipment
The 6-pin 80W flywheel alternator feeds the 12V - 18 Ah battery through the rectifier-regulator group
The charging circuit is protected by a fuse (15A) located on the wiring block on the crossbar under the seat. The user circuits are protected by 5 fuses (8A each), arranged below the dashboard.
The direction indicators flasher unit and the electrical wiper switch (accessory) are live only with the ignition switched on (ie key and switch on the dashboard in the positions 1,2,3)
The horn and rear stop lights can be operated without ignition key inserted.
The battery must be always regularly connected, otherwise engine start can be faulty and dangerous overloading of the circuits can occur during running.
The red indicator bulb on the dashboard comes on with the ignition on and stays on with the engine running. Should turn off when the ignition is switched off

Engine
Engine: | Single cylinder two stoke, forced air cooled. | Carburettor | Dell’Orto MA 19 BS 7 – Cartridge type air filter |
Bore: | 62mm | Choke: | 19 |
Stroke: | 58mm | Max. Jet: | 80 |
Capacity: | 175cc | Pilot Jet: | 40 |
Compression Ratio: | 7 | Starter Jet: | 55 |
Output: | 7 H.P. at 4750 R.P.M. | Atomizer | 260 B |
Needle mounted on the middle notch | D 21 |
Ignition | flywheel alternator, battery, external HT coil. Fixed advance |
Spark Plug: | during running in – 225 Bosch scale heat range |
after running-in – 225 – 240 Bosch scale heat range, according to conditions | |
Start: | Pedal / Kickstart (on the left of the engine) |
Clutch: | Multi-disc type in oil bath |
Gear Box: | gearbox with four speeds and reverse constant mesh gears ,alternately splined to the secondary shaft by coupling sliders |
Total transmission ratios (Rear Wheel RPM/ENGINE RPM) |
1st gear: 1/28.050 |
2nd gear: 1/16.107 | |
3rd gear: 1/10.131 | |
4th gear: 1/6.875 | |
Reverse: 1/29.987 | |
Transmission | From engine to gearbox: by gears with flexible coupling. |
From gearbox to rear axle: by hollow shaft with splined couplings and two flexible couplings |
